Smoke cleaning in Washington, D.C. properties involves removing soot residue and eliminating pervasive odors. Licensed pros assess the type of smoke damage and use specialized cleaning agents and equipment to carefully clean surfaces without causing further harm. Advanced deodorization techniques, such as air scrubbing and ozone treatments, are employed to neutralize smoke smells and restore the indoor air quality of the affected property.
